Abstract

The purpose of thestudy was to evaluate the behavioral changes of male and female adultrats exposed to fine and ultrafine particulate matter (PM≤2,5) suspended in air pollution during development. Wistar rats aged 7 postnataldayswere exposed to the chamber of an atmospheric particle concentrator. Open field tests and sucrose preference tests were performed to assess the presence of anxiety and depression behaviors. Male rats from the pollution group showed reduced locomotor activity and length of stay in the open field center when compared to the control group. The sucrose preference test showed statistical significance between the pollution and control groups(male+female), and among the males of the pollution and control group.The study concluded thatexposure to PM≤2.5 causes behavioral changes characteristic of depression and anxietyin adult male rats exposed during the developmental period.
